About

Svetlana Vinokurova is a scholar working on Epidemiology, Molecular Biology and Oncology. According to data from OpenAlex, Svetlana Vinokurova has authored 47 papers receiving a total of 2.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 33 papers in Epidemiology, 22 papers in Molecular Biology and 14 papers in Oncology. Recurrent topics in Svetlana Vinokurova’s work include Cervical Cancer and HPV Research (32 papers), Molecular Biology Techniques and Applications (10 papers) and Cancer-related Molecular Pathways (8 papers). Svetlana Vinokurova is often cited by papers focused on Cervical Cancer and HPV Research (32 papers), Molecular Biology Techniques and Applications (10 papers) and Cancer-related Molecular Pathways (8 papers). Svetlana Vinokurova collaborates with scholars based in Germany, Russia and United States. Svetlana Vinokurova's co-authors include Magnus von Knebel Doeberitz, Nicolas Wentzensen, F. L. Kisseljov, Peter Melsheimer, Ruediger Klaes, Miriam Reuschenbach, Achim Schneider, Irene Kraus, Christine Bergeron and Jens Einenkel and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, JNCI Journal of the National Cancer Institute and Cancer Research.
